Product Model
FLT-CP-1C-350

Selling Points
- 1High continuous voltage of 350 V AC for 230/400 V AC networks with high voltage fluctuations.
- 2Plugs can be checked with CHECKMASTER for easy maintenance.
- 3Optical, mechanical status indication for individual arresters.
- 4Thermal disconnect device for each individual plug ensures safety.
- 5Compatible with DIN rail mounting, easy installation on 35 mm rails.
